Job Summary

Cardinal Ritter College Prep is seeking an enthusiastic and skilled Assistant Band Director to support the leadership and growth of its band program. This role assists with rehearsals, concert and marching band preparation, and student skill development, while also helping manage logistics such as equipment, uniforms, and travel. The ideal candidate brings strong musical expertise, effective communication and organizational skills, and a passion for inspiring students and fostering a positive, inclusive band culture.

Job Responsibilities

  • Leading sectional rehearsals and individual skill development.
  • Assisting with concert preparation, music selection, and arranging.
  • Supporting marching band activities, including rehearsals, drills, and performances.
  • Managing logistical tasks such as inventory, uniform distribution, and transportation coordination.
  • Collaborating with the Director to plan and execute band trips and competitions.
  • Providing leadership and guidance to student leaders and section captains.

Job Requirements

  • Strong musical expertise with proficiency in multiple instruments.
  • Excellent organizational and communication skills.
  • Ability to inspire and motivate students of varying skill levels.
  • Commitment to fostering a positive and inclusive band culture.
